What is Eating Disorder Management Program?
Eating Disorder Management Program
Dealing with an eating disorder can be a deeply personal and emotional experience that not just affects your relationship with food, but overall relationship with yourself. Historically, eating disorders were seen to be specific to females. Over the years it’s been realised that eating disorders can occur across the age and the gender spectrum though the predominant age spectrum continues to be teens and young adults.
Eating disorders can be of various kinds:
1. Anorexia nervous: It is characterised by distorted body image, an intense pursuit of thinness and an associated fear of gaining weight. The individuals place significant importance on controlling their weight by using extreme efforts like restricting the amount of food being eaten, excessive exercise etc. that tend to negatively affect their health and their lives.
2. Bulimia nervous: It is characterised by recurrent episodes of binge eating, followed by purging behaviours examples. Individuals may experience a sense of shame, guilt and fear of weight gain post-binge. Usually, individuals with this disorder maintain a relatively normal weight.
3. Binge eating disorder: It is characterised by recurrent episodes of eating excessive amounts of food in a short period, often to the point of feeling uncomfortably full or experiencing physical pain.
Eating disorders are associated with significant distress impairment in psychosocial and are known to cause multiple physical health conditions.

Psychotherapy: We, at Adayu, understand that healing from an eating disorder is unique and requires a tailored approach. We see psychotherapy from an eclectic perspective and offer a variety of therapeutic modalities prominently using Cognitive Behavioural Therapy, Family Based Therapy, Dialectical Behaviour Therapy.
We also believe that therapeutic approaches go beyond traditional psychotherapy, the inclusion of art-based therapy into our treatment program gives you the opportunity to explore and express your inner self through various forms of art, clay sculpting, music and movement.
